# 内容主体大纲1. **介绍Matic和麦子钱包** - Matic网络概述 - 麦子钱包的功能与特点2. **为什么选择麦子钱包** - 安全性分...
以太坊Geth钱包是以太坊区块链上的一种钱包软件,它是以太坊官方提供的命令行工具。使用Geth钱包可以管理以太币和与以太坊区块链进行交互。
在使用Geth钱包之前,需要先下载和安装Geth钱包软件。安装完成后,可以通过输入命令行来执行各种操作。
常用的Geth钱包命令包括:
geth account new
:创建一个新的以太坊账户geth --datadir=/path/to/data init /path/to/genesis.json
:初始化以太坊区块链geth --datadir=/path/to/data console
:打开以太坊控制台geth --datadir=/path/to/data --networkid=1234 --rpc --rpcaddr=0.0.0.0 --rpccorsdomain="*"
:启动以太坊节点geth attach /path/to/data/geth.ipc
:连接到一个正在运行的Geth节点通过这些命令,用户可以创建账户、初始化区块链、打开控制台、启动节点以及连接到正在运行的节点进行交互。
Geth钱包提供了发送和接收以太币的功能,可以通过以下步骤进行操作:
personal.unlockAccount(address)
来解锁发送方账户,其中address
为发送方账户地址。eth.sendTransaction({from: sender, to: recipient, value: amount})
来发送以太币,其中sender
为发送方账户地址,recipient
为接收方账户地址,amount
为发送金额。接收以太币只需要分享自己的以太坊地址给发送方即可。
为了确保账户安全,建议定期备份Geth钱包。
备份Geth钱包的步骤如下:
如果需要恢复Geth钱包,可以按照以下步骤进行:
Geth钱包提供了查看以太坊交易记录的功能。
可以通过以下步骤来查看交易记录:
eth.getBlock(blockNumber)
来获取指定区块的交易信息,其中blockNumber
为区块号。eth.getTransaction(txHash)
来获取指定交易的详细信息,其中txHash
为交易哈希。通过这些命令,用户可以获取到区块和交易的相关信息,包括交易的发送方、接收方、交易金额等。
在Geth钱包中,用户可以自定义交易费用,该费用决定了交易的优先级和确认时间。
可以通过以下步骤设置交易费用:
eth.gasPrice
来查看当前区块链上的平均交易费用。eth.getTransactionCount(address)
来查看发送方账户的交易次数。eth.sendTransaction({from: sender, to: recipient, value: amount, gas: gasLimit, gasPrice: gasPrice})
来设置交易费用。交易费用的设置需要根据当前网络情况和个人需求进行合理调整。